Abstract

A transmission resonator implemented in fin-line technique is rigorously analysed by applying the method of equivalent rectangular waveguides. Based on these results, bandpass filters with up to 5 resonators are designed taking the higher-order mode coupling between the resonators into account. It is shown that this effect is of considerable importance in the design of fin-line bandpass filters.
